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
46 382138 52 111415924
623448 2879908 2799
623448 2879908 2799
4678 435155 312
All about undefined
Interested in learning more?
623448 2879908 2799
4678 435155 312
See more
101 8014 4012
8542474385 68490 3414194
See more
67 490684
35 9953 3025021 40751584 144032824
See more